nutcracker

/nʌtkrækər/ noun · British & US

What does nutcracker mean?

noun

A device used to crack open nuts, typically by applying pressure with a lever or screw. A ballet, The Nutcracker, based on E.T.A. Hoffmann's 1816 fairy tale.

Example

"She used a nutcracker to crack open the walnuts for the holiday dessert."
